In this video we are learning Naatadavu - 2nd variation with Naatu and Kattu ‘Naatu’ means stretch to your side/Kick ‘Kattu' means to cross your leg back in Swastika position and 'Adavu' refers to basic steps in Bharatanatyam. Kattadavu Also comes in three speeds: Vilamba Kala - Slow Speed Madyama Kala - Medium Speed Dhruta Kala - Fast Speed Thank you, Sindhu 🙏 #bharatanat...

Speaking through Hastas(hand gestures) The Indian classical dance tradition, hand gestures or mudras are widely used to convey everything from emotions to objects to happenings to living beings to situations. Asamyukta hastas are done using single hand. The Nathyashastra mentions about 28 single hand gestures. They are as follows Pataka - flag Tripataka- a flag with three...

Namaste! In this video, we are learning the variations of Thattadavu 3,4,5 Thattadavu: Thattu means to strike. In this adavu, we are just striking our feet on the floor in the aramandi position. Hands can be either at the hips or in natyarambha position. There are 7 variations in thattadavu. Sollokattu for 3rd time Thattu 3.Thai Thai thaam - In aramandi we strike our feet 3 times alternately ri...
